Ranchi, President Droupadi Murmu will attend the forty fifth convocation ceremony of IIT in Dhanbad on Friday.
On Thursday, Murmu attended the inaugural convocation of AIIMS Deoghar, which marked the commencement of the institute’s first MBBS batch, admitted in 2019.
Throughout the convocation at IIT in Dhanbad, Murmu will confer the President’s Gold Medal to Priyanshu Sharma, the top-ranking BTech graduate in pc science and engineering, officers mentioned.
A complete of 1,880 college students from the 2024-25 batch can be awarded levels throughout varied disciplines, marking their formal induction into the league of achieved IIT alumni, they added.
A complete of 37 college students will get gold medals, 35 silver, and 21 will get sponsored medals and awards throughout the ceremony, they added.
Governor Santosh Gangwar and Chief Minister Hemant Soren are additionally anticipated to be current on the occasion along with Union Minister Dharmendra Pradhan.
“The convocation holds particular significance because it varieties a central a part of the institute’s centenary celebrations, symbolising 100 years of unwavering dedication to nation-building by means of science, know-how, and schooling”, one other official mentioned.
The institute, established on December 9, 1926, started its journey because the Indian College of Mines and Utilized Geology.
Modeled on the Royal College of Mines, London, the institute was based with the particular goal of coaching extremely expert professionals for India’s fast-growing mining trade.
The muse of the institute was laid underneath the visionary steerage of its first Principal, David Penman, and it was formally inaugurated by Lord Irwin, the then Viceroy of India.
Murmu would be the second President to attend a convocation ceremony at IIT-ISM, Dhanbad.
Former President Pranab Mukherjee had graced the thirty sixth convocation of the institute because the chief visitor on Could 10, 2014.
